Oxprenoate (RU 28318) potassium is an orally active, brain-penetrant selective mineralocorticoid receptor antagonist that blocks Aldosterone (HY-113313) signaling through competitive binding to MR, and exhibits anxiolytic and neuroprotective activities, as well as modulates Corticosterone (HY-B1618) levels. Oxprenoate potassium is used in research on hypertension, anxiety disorders, depression, Alzheimer's disease, and glucocorticoid-related neuronal injury .

Norbaeocystin is an intermediate/minor metabolite naturally present in the psilocybin biosynthetic pathway of hallucinogenic mushrooms (Psilocybe spp.). Norbaeocystin has weak or no affinity for the serotonin 2A (5-HT2A) receptor and does not induce receptor activation. Norbaeocystin is rapidly metabolized by monoamine oxidase, and thus does not participate in centrally mediated psychedelic effects. Norbaeocystin can be used for studies on biological pathways associated with hallucinogenic effects .

Mobam is a insecticide against Anoplura Pediculidae. Mobam inhibits cholinesterase (ChE) levels in rats plasma, erythrocytes, and brain, suppresses the avoidance behavior in rats .

Carvotroline hydrochloride is an antipsychotic agent and 5-HT2 receptor antagonist, with a Ki value of 211 nM for the 5-HT2 receptor. Carvotroline hydrochloride modulates the activity of the stress-related hypothalamic-pituitary-adrenal axis. Carvotroline hydrochloride exerts a stronger blocking effect on Apomorphine (HY-12723)-induced climbing behavior than on Apomorphine-induced stereotyped behavior. Carvotroline hydrochloride inhibits conditioned avoidance responses in rats and monkeys without inducing catalepsy. Carvotroline hydrochloride can be used in studies related to schizophrenia .

RTICBM-74 is a blood-brain barrier-permeable, selective CB1 allosteric modulator with IC50 values of 23 nM (calcium mobilization assay) and 153 nM ([ 35S]GTPγS assay). RTICBM-74 inhibits CB1 receptor signaling. RTICBM-74 reduces alcohol intake in rats. RTICBM-74 can be used for the research of alcohol use disorder .

Phenindamine hydrochloride (Nu 1504 hydrochloride) is the hydrochloride salt of Phenindamine (HY-A0149). Phenindamine is a histamine H1 receptor antagonist. Phenindamine hydrochloride mainly exists in the 9-9a ene configuration and as a mixture of protonated epimers. Phenindamine hydrochloride can be used in studies related to histamine H1 receptor antagonists and the salt-type structure of Phenindamine .
